Faecal microbiota transplant from aged donor mice affects spatial learning and memory via modulating hippocampal synaptic plasticity- and neurotransmission-related proteins in young recipients

BACKGROUND: The gut-brain axis and the intestinal microbiota are emerging as key players in health and disease.
